Biophan CEO Michael Weiner to Present Latest Biomedical Advancements at Boston University Nanotechnology Event

Biophan Technologies, Inc., a developer of next-generation medical technology, will present an overview of its novel biomedical advancements and nanotechnology-based solutions at the "Frontiers of Science within Nanotechnology Workshop," to be held August 25-27 at Boston University's Photonics Center in Boston, MA.

The three-day workshop will feature an array of presentations of the latest research and views on the future of "The Science within Nanotechnology." CEO Michael Weiner, an invited speaker, will discuss Biophan's suite of cutting-edge healthcare solutions and proprietary technologies in a moderated discussion beginning at 2 p.m. on August 25.

"Biophan's research and development programs have yielded an extensive number of biomedical solutions at the leading-edge of nanotechnology," Mr. Weiner said. "These solutions include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I) visualization of restenosis in stents, visualizable vena cava filters, enhanced MRI contrast agents, active and controllable drug delivery, long-lasting power systems using bio-thermal energy, and other medical innovations. It is Biophan's intention to further advance scientific biomedical and pharmaceutical innovation and technology development for the benefit of improved healthcare products worldwide." Biophan's technologies also make medical devices safe for MRI.

Individual presentations will also address such topics as the roles of complex and correlated matter in nanotechnology. A plenary discussion will follow, providing a critical overview of the possible frontiers of science within nanotechnology.
